Thymus serpyllum ‘Elfin’ (10) ct FlatCommon names: Elfin Thyme, dwarf thyme, creeping thyme
- Height: 1-2 Inches
- Spread: 12-18 Inches
- Hardiness Zone: 4-8
- Full Sun to Part Shade
- Evergreen ornamental herb
- Tolerates light foot traffic
- Cascades Over Walls
Thymus serpyllum ‘Elfin’, commonly known as Elfin thyme, is a dwarf variety of creeping thyme that is native to Europe and Asia. It is a member of the mint family (Lamiaceae) and is closely related to the common thyme. The name “Elfin” refers to the plant’s small size.
Elfin thyme grows to a height of only 1-2 inches and spreads to a width of 12-18 inches. An evergreen herb, leaves are small and gray-green in color. The flowers are small and purple-pink and appear in summer.
Elfin thyme prefers full sun and well-drained soil. Once established Elfin is drought-tolerant and does not require much care. Performs best with average water and well-drained soil – even rocky, sandy, poor soil. Will cascade over walls and grow well between stones.
Easy to grow and tolerate foot traffic for Elfin thyme is a popular choice for groundcover, in borders, rock gardens and between steppingstones.
- Water regularly during the first year after planting.
- Fertilize once a year in spring with a balanced fertilizer.
- Pinch back the flowers to encourage growth.
- Divide every 3-4 years to keep the plant healthy.
